Sterling shocks Liverpool over contract demands

Raheem Sterling is demanding a bumper pay-hike to stay with Liverpool. The Daily Mail says Sterling, who has burst into the first team at Anfield this season, has 18 months to run on a deal worth £2,000 a week plus appearance bonuses and has clubs keen on luring him away from Merseyside.

He is 18 next month and although money was not discussed at the meeting, Liverpool have been preparing terms in the region of £20,000 a week.

Sterling's camp, however, have made it clear they would reject such an offer and consider their options. They believe he deserves closer to £50,000 a week, putting him in the same bracket as other established first-teamers. Stewart Downing, barely picked this season, earns £60,000 a week.
